Laminate Floor Remodeling in Longmont, CO
Laminate floor remodeling services involve updating and enhancing existing laminate flooring to improve appearance and functionality. This can include replacing damaged or worn planks, refinishing surfaces to restore their original look, or installing new laminate flooring to match updated design preferences. Homeowners often seek these services when their current flooring shows signs of wear, such as scratches, fading, or water damage, or when they want to refresh the style of a room without a complete renovation. Projects can range from small areas like a single room to larger spaces that require extensive floor updates.
Before requesting laminate floor remodeling, property owners typically want to understand the scope of work involved, including the removal of old flooring, preparation of the subfloor, and the types of laminate options available. It's also important to consider factors such as the durability of different laminate styles, the installation process, and how the new flooring will coordinate with existing interior elements. Clarifying these details helps ensure the remodeling aligns with both aesthetic goals and functional needs.

Laminate Floor Remodeling Questions
What types of laminate flooring are available for remodeling projects? There are various styles and finishes, including wood-look, stone-look, and textured surfaces to match different design preferences.
Can laminate flooring be installed over existing floors? Yes, laminate can often be installed over existing hard surfaces, provided they are level and in good condition.
Is laminate flooring suitable for high-traffic areas? Yes, laminate is durable and resistant to scratches and dents, making it a practical choice for busy spaces.
What should homeowners consider before remodeling with laminate flooring? It's important to consider the room's moisture levels, subfloor condition, and the desired style to ensure a successful installation.
